As many of us expected, Kai Forbath won the Lou Groza Award for being the best collegiate place-kicker. It was great to read about more Bruins being recognized:
Earlier in the day, Forbath was named first-team Walter Camp All-American.
UCLA defensive tackle Brian Price and safety Rahim Moore were named to the second team. Price, a junior, finished third nationally with 22.5 tackles for a loss. Moore, a sophomore, led the nation with nine interceptions.
Only Alabama (six) and Florida (four) had more players named to the teams. Texas also had three. Those three teams were a combined 38-1 this season. UCLA finished 6-6.
